Abstract
Background: Accurately predicting outcomes for cardiac arrest (CA) survivors is essential. Existing severity scores reliably predict outcomes at hospital discharge, but their prognostic performance for survival at 6 months and 1 year remains unexplored. Methods: This retrospective observational study enrolled 1773 adult nontraumatic CA patients in the emergency department of National Taiwan University Hospital between January 2011 and June 2023 without interhospital transfer. Data on clinical variables, resuscitation events, post-arrest care, and outcomes were collected, and the severity was classified using the sCAHP, rCAST, and TIMECARD scores. The outcomes included 6-month and 1-year survival. Predictive ability was evaluated using receiver operating characteristic (ROC) curves. Results: Among 1773 enrolled patients, 501 (28.3%) survived to discharge, 361 (20.4%) to 6 months, and 346 (19.5%) to 1 year. The area under the ROC curves (AUCs) for 6-month survival were 0.787, 0.733, and 0.810 for the sCAHP, rCAST, and TIMECARD scores, respectively. For 1-year survival, the AUC values were 0.788, 0.734, and 0.816, respectively. sCAHP and TIMECARD scores demonstrated better discriminatory performance than did the rCAST score for both 6-month and 1-year survival. Compared with the sCAHP and rCAST scores, TIMECARD score exhibited superior discrimination for 1-year survival, particularly in patients ≤65 years, those with in-hospital CA (IHCA), and those with good pre-arrest neurological status. Conclusion: The sCAHP, rCAST, and TIMECARD scores demonstrated good discrimination and calibration for long-term survival. The TIMECARD score exhibited better discriminatory performance for 1-year survival, particularly in the subgroup of younger age, IHCA, and good pre-arrest neurological function.
